Two women from Assam suffer injuries in leopard attack in Mudigere

Two plantation workers from Assam suffered injuries after being attacked by a leopard in Gowthalli village, Mudigere taluk, Chikkamagaluru district, on Monday.

Sabina Samad and Sultan Javed were working at a coffee estate belonging to Chandre Gowda on Monday morning when the wild animal attacked them. As they raised their voices for help, the animal ran away. Both suffered injuries to their backs, necks, and legs. Other workers at the plantation moved them to a hospital in Mudigere

Following the incident, the officers of the Forest Department visited the site. Residents are concerned about the incident, as they are already facing issues with elephants. The people who gathered at Gowthalli urged the Forest Department to take measures to prevent human-wildlife conflict in the area.
